The social activist documentary The Tsunami Diaries: A Journey to the Epicenter chronicles the relief mission of two young men, in response to the infamous tsunami-fueled destruction of the Indonesian coast on December 26, 2004. When an earthquake struck on the day after Christmas, massacring 275,000 individuals and injuring untold numbers of others, surfer Timmy Turner and cinematographer Dustin Humphrey initially trekked out to Java and planned to document the devastation for the rest of the world to see. The duo quickly realized, however, that far nobler actions were necessary - specifically, a massive grass-roots campaign for social relief that involved bringing food, doctors, medical supplies and goats to impoverished villages in Sumatra. The Tsunami Diaries chronicles the young men's awe-inspiring humanitarian mission. ~ Nathan Southern, All Movie Guide
